The soil seed bank can buffer long-term compositional changes in annual plant communities

Niv DeMalach et al.

Summary: The composition of the seed bank differs from the standing vegetation over the years, with small-seeded and dormant-seeded species having higher frequency in the seed bank. There is no significant difference in the year-to-year variability between the seed bank and vegetation, but long-term compositional trends are weaker in the seed bank compared to the vegetation.

Temporal stability of biomass in annual plant communities is driven by species diversity and asynchrony, but not dominance

Jaime Kigel et al.

Summary: The study reveals that biomass stability in annual plant communities in the Mediterranean region is higher due to factors such as increased biomass production, species richness, and evenness. Species asynchrony plays a key role in driving stability at the local spatial scale. Biomass production and richness indirectly affect stability through asynchrony, but with different impacts at each site.

Drivers of seedling establishment success in dryland restoration efforts

Nancy Shackelford et al.

Summary: Restoration of degraded drylands is crucial to mitigate climate change, with seeding of native species playing a critical role. Research shows that around one-third of seeding projects are successful, while 17% fail. Success of seeding establishment is influenced by factors such as seeding rate, seed size, site aridity, taxonomic identity, and species life form.

Extreme drought has limited effects on soil seed bank composition in desert grasslands

Alejandro Loydi et al.

Summary: In the blue grama community, rainfall treatments increased above-ground vegetation and seed bank richness, while not affecting the black grama community. Vegetation cover was affected by both rainfall manipulations, but seed bank density increased or remained the same. Drought led to an increase in cover of annual and perennial forbs in above-ground vegetation.
